Text is clear, readable; vintage photos are clean, vivid. This well-written book follows the chronology of Japan's invasion of China, and examines the war in China. According to the author, the war began in China, not Pearl Harbor. Here is intelligent insights into battles such as the six-month struggle for Guadalcanal, Return to Guam, Iwo Jima, the epic Leyte Gulf battle, Truk, and Rabaul. There are 16 chapters describing major personalities of the war, which helps the reader understand why certain events happened the way they did. Overall, the author unfolds to the reader the history-making events of World War II in the Pacific.
